Itinerary Highlights

Brussels: City Highlights Walking Tour and Food Tasting - Itinerary Highlights

This captivating Brussels city highlights tour kicks off at the picturesque Putterie 1 in Mont des Arts, where visitors embark on a 2.5-hour journey through the city’s most iconic landmarks and culinary delights.

For 45 minutes, the group will enjoy the grandeur of the Grand Place, sampling local street food and soaking in the sights.

Next, they’ll venture into the charming Royal Saint-Hubert Galleries for 15 minutes, indulging in more local snacks and food tastings.

The tour then continues to the beloved Manneken Pis statue for 15 minutes of sightseeing, before culminating in a 1-hour beer tasting session at a cozy neighborhood bar.

Interspersed throughout the route, visitors will also enjoy 30 minutes of scenic walking, taking in the city’s captivating architecture and atmosphere.

Accessibility and Requirements

Brussels: City Highlights Walking Tour and Food Tasting - Accessibility and Requirements

Wheelchair users can comfortably join this Brussels city highlights tour, which caters to their accessibility needs.

Those with mobility impairments, however, may find the walking portions challenging and should exercise caution.

Comfortable shoes and weather-appropriate clothing are highly recommended for all participants to fully enjoy the diverse experiences on this tour.

The tour isn’t suitable for children under 6 years old, as the pace and duration may prove too demanding for younger guests.
